概括
这项研究通过使用RSA加密和多因素身份验证,包括面部验证和设备匹配来增强在线投票的安全性. 该系统确保安全的数据保护和用户身份验证,以实现更具弹性的数字民主.

背景情况:
- 在线投票系统面临着重大的网络安全挑战.
- 确保选民数据的完整性和系统安全性对于民主进程至关重要.
- 现有的系统往往缺乏全面的多层安全协议.
研究的目的:
- 开发和评估一个创新的,安全的在线投票系统.
- 整合先进的安全措施,以提供强大的数据保护.
- 加强用户身份验证并防止网络漏洞.
主要方法:
- 实现Rivest-Shamir-Adleman (RSA) 加密和解密,以确保数据安全.
- 整合移动FaceNet用于面部验证.
- 使用设备指纹匹配和多因素身份验证.
- 通过 Firebase 数据库安全存储和验证用户数据.
主要成果:
- 拟议的系统表明了对在线投票安全性的强化方法.
- 多个安全层的成功集成提供了针对网络威胁的弹性盾牌.
- RSA加密确保了安全的数据传输和存储,防止未经授权的访问.
结论:
- 开发的在线投票系统显著提高了安全性和数据保护.
- 多层安全方法,包括RSA加密,为数字投票提供了强大的解决方案.
- 这项创新旨在提高在线投票的可访问性,便利性和参与度,同时降低成本.

Radial System Protection
95
Radial systems employ time-delay overcurrent relays to reduce load interruptions. When a fault occurs, the nearest breaker opens first, while upstream breakers remain closed due to longer delay settings. This approach ensures minimal disruption to the rest of the system.
In a radial system with a fault downstream of the third breaker, ideally, only the third breaker will open, isolating the fault and interrupting the load connected beyond it. The second breaker has a longer delay setting,...

Norton's Theorem
592
Norton's theorem is a fundamental principle stating that a linear two-terminal circuit can be substituted with an equivalent circuit, which comprises a current source (ⅠN) in parallel with a resistor (RN). Here, ⅠN represents the short-circuit current flowing through the terminals, and RN stands for the input or equivalent resistance at the terminals when all independent sources are deactivated.
